Output 10b3088666a97eadb374fbacffbb4f2e6d5f90d177718397fba031ed8e34cd66:176

value
115589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d1ca0e9eccc4c0d6027fe347755d70d54df6a7c OP_EQUAL
address
3EZ9VjrfV2n2C7cQcVxFoz6wncgYNJz9bQ
transaction
10b3088666a97eadb374fbacffbb4f2e6d5f90d177718397fba031ed8e34cd66
spent
true